I received a new putter cover today custom made be Delilah Club Covers.  It is a really great option if you’re looking for something custom.  She will work with you to ensure you get the design you want and the product is high quality.  She takes a different approach with the magnet closure on the blade head cover that I really like.  I’ve had swag and blue birdie (now hatch) head covers and the quality of this cover is on par with those brands.  I recommend checking her out if you’re looking for a new cover.

I ordered June 28th and recieved it today.   Not quick but not 6 months.   The made to order aspect takes some time.  

 

Of the two I think Swag slightly edges out Hatch.   The material swag uses is very sturdy.  Feels like it will last forever.   The hatch I have is actually blue birdie which i believe is the same people just different names  it they do have different styles now so they may use different materials also.   All three of these options are high quality products.

I’ve been using a Swag cover for the past 3 months (at least 20 rounds) in the rain and all kinds of different weather conditions. I take it on and off for every hole, throw it around, and beat it up a bunch. It still looks brand new and is still stiff and sturdy. I’m very curious about Hatch and also Delilah. I owned a Xenon Delilah cover a while back and it seemed really cheap and flimsy to me. However, it was a super old used one so I have no idea how much it was used before I got it. For all I know, the cover was used for 500 rounds.
